About The Book

Development Learning and Community uses data drawn from a study of pluralistic Jewish high schools to illustrate the complex and often challenging interplay between the cognitive and socio-aff ective elements of education. Throughout Kress grapples with questions such as: How can the balance between community cohesion and group diff erences be achieved in diverse settings? What are the educational implications of an approach to identity development rooted in contemporary developmental theories that posit the interaction among cognition aff ect and behavior? How can the formal and informal off erings of a school coalesce to address these broadly conceived identity outcomes and what are the challenges in doing so?
